Avast Ye Mateys

Over the course of the last several years, there has been a lot of harsh rhetoric between North Korea and the United States. Recent allegations of the rogue nation's involvement in a suspected nuclear project in Syria certainly didn't help matters.

That's what makes a recent skirmish in the Indian Ocean all the more interesting. When a North Korean freighter was attacked by pirates off the coast of Somalia, it was a United States guided missile destroyer that came to the aid of the Dai Hong Dan. The crew of the freighter had managed to get off a distress signal before being overpowered. The USS James E. Williams responded by sending a helicopter to investigate. When the chopper arrived on the scene, the pirates became distracted long enough for the North Koreans to overpower their attackers. Two of the pirates were killed in the ensuing gun battle, and five others were captured.
